What Are the Advantages of Using Cast Iron Adjustable Dumbbells?

Cast iron adjustable dumbbells offer several advantages that make them a popular choice for strength training:


AdvantageDescription
VersatilityAdjustable dumbbells allow users to change weights easily, accommodating different exercises and fitness levels.
Space-savingInstead of having multiple dumbbells, adjustable ones take up less space, making them ideal for home gyms.
Cost-effectivePurchasing a single set of adjustable dumbbells can be more economical compared to buying multiple fixed-weight dumbbells.
DurabilityCast iron is known for its strength and longevity, ensuring the dumbbells can withstand heavy use.
Progressive TrainingUsers can gradually increase weight as they build strength, which is essential for muscle growth.
SafetyAdjustable dumbbells often come with features that enhance safety during workouts, such as secure locking mechanisms.
Variety of ExercisesWith adjustable weights, users can perform a wider range of exercises, targeting different muscle groups effectively.

How Do Weight Adjustments Function in Cast Iron Models?

Weight adjustments in cast iron models, such as adjustable dumbbells, function by allowing users to modify the weight load easily to suit their training requirements. This flexibility helps to accommodate different fitness levels and exercise routines.

The primary mechanisms of weight adjustments in cast iron dumbbells include:

  • Weight Plates: Cast iron dumbbells often come with removable weight plates. Users can add or remove plates to achieve the desired weight. For example, a standard adjustable dumbbell may come with plates weighing 2.5 kg and 5 kg.

  • Adjustment Mechanism: Most adjustable dumbbells feature a simple locking system that secures the weight plates in place. Users can twist a collar, press a button, or use a pin system to lock in the selected weight. This ensures safety during workouts.

  • Incremental Adjustments: Many models allow for incremental adjustments, typically in small increments of 1.25 kg to 2.5 kg. This helps users gradually increase weight as they progress in their strength training programs.

  • Durability and Stability: Cast iron provides durability and stability to the weights. This material can withstand the repeated impact of weight training without cracking or breaking.

  • Compact Design: Adjustable dumbbells with cast iron weights often have a compact design. This allows for easier storage and more efficient use of space in home gyms, compared to fixed-weight dumbbells.

Why Is Durability Crucial for Home Gym Dumbbells?

Durability is crucial for home gym dumbbells because it ensures long-lasting performance and safety during workouts. Durable dumbbells withstand regular usage, reducing the risk of damage that could lead to injury.

According to the American Council on Exercise, durability in exercise equipment refers to the ability to withstand wear, pressure, or damage over time. This definition highlights the importance of using high-quality materials in the production of dumbbells.

The underlying reasons for prioritizing durability include safety, cost-effectiveness, and user experience. Durable dumbbells prevent breakage during intense workouts, which can cause injuries. They also represent a better investment, as high-quality products last longer and reduce the need for frequent replacements. A positive user experience is also enhanced by the reliability of the equipment during various exercises.

Common materials used in dumbbell construction include iron, rubber, and neoprene. Iron provides excellent strength, while rubber coating adds grip and protects floors. Neoprene is another popular material, known for its cushioned grip and resistance to moisture. These materials must undergo rigorous testing to ensure durability and safety standards.

Specific conditions that contribute to the need for robust dumbbells include frequent drops and exposure to moisture. For instance, users may drop dumbbells during exercises, especially when fatigued, which can lead to cracks or breaks in less durable models. Additionally, excessive moisture from sweat can lead to rust in cheaper metal dumbbells, further degrading their integrity and lifespan.
